You may have heard of SAP software. It’s a software application used by a major percentage of medium sized and large enterprises all over the world. The prime use of the software application is to connect the whole company together and allow hundreds and often thousands of workers to store, share and view data concerning the physical and financial processes of the company. Significant organisations are managed by intelligent people who appreciate the strategic value of this type of software, such as how it can give them insight into why issues are occurring inside their business or where there might be opportunity for refinements.
This type of system is commonly known as ERP. It is very complex, very costly and can take along time to implement. A deployment of ERP software can cost ten’s of millions of dollars but this doesn’t stand in the way of substantial firms buying these systems.
